Common Issues and Errors Related to FlashUtil10zq_ActiveX.dll
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:
- The file FlashUtil10zq_ActiveX.dll is missing: This suggests that a DLL file required for certain functionalities is not available in your system. This could have occurred due to manual deletion, system restore, or a recent software uninstallation.
- Cannot register FlashUtil10zq_ActiveX.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
- FlashUtil10zq_ActiveX.dll could not be loaded: This means that the DLL file required by a specific program or process could not be loaded into memory. This could be due to corruption of the DLL file, improper installation, or compatibility issues with your operating system.
- FlashUtil10zq_ActiveX.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message indicates that the DLL file is either not compatible with your Windows version or has an internal problem. It could be due to a programming error in the DLL, or an attempt to use a DLL from a different version of Windows.
- FlashUtil10zq_ActiveX.dll Access Violation: This indicates a process tried to access or modify a memory location related to FlashUtil10zq_ActiveX.dll that it isn't allowed to. This is often a sign of problems with the software using the DLL, such as bugs or corruption.
